If your water... WebNov 1, 2024 · Dial or rotate the gas control knob to the pilot position. Hold down th gas control knob and depress it. Right after a second, press the ignition button till the status light begins to blink every few seconds. This indicates that the pilot of the water heater is lit. This whole process will take approximately 1 minute for a newly installed unit.
WebFeb 4, 2024 · Light the pilot: Keep the knob or pilot button pressed down as you relight the burner with a utility lighter. Continue to hold: Keep holding down the pilot knob or button for at least a minute after the flame ignites. This will ensure the pilot remains lit. Switch the knob back to ON: Let go of the pilot knob or button.
